@@ -45,6 +43,9 @@ https://github.com/g-truc/glm `cglm` doesn't alloc any memory on heap. So it doesn't provide any allocator. You should alloc memory for **out** parameters too if you pass pointer of memory location. Don't forget that **vec4** (also quat/**versor**) and **mat4** must be aligned (16-bytes), because *cglm* uses SIMD instructions to optimize most operations if available. #### Returning vector or matrix... ? + +**cglm** supports both *ARRAY API* and *STRUCT API*, so you can return structs if you you struct api (`glms_`). + Since almost all types are arrays and **C** doesn't allow returning arrays, so **cglm** doesn't support this feature.
